Product Description:

The MDD071B-N-060-N2S-095GL0 synchronous motor is built by Bosch Rexroth Indramat and belongs to the MDD Synchronous Motors series. Designed for use with digital drive controllers, it converts electrical power into rotary motion for positioning and velocity control in automated machinery. The housing follows the standard frame style used in this motor line, so it fits machine layouts that accept the same platform. Its purpose is to deliver repeatable torque and speed under closed-loop control in industrial automation systems.

Accurate alignment on the machine plate is provided by a 95 mm centering pilot, and the rotor uses standard dynamic balancing to reduce vibration at operating speed. Power and encoder cables exit on the left side, which suits installations that route conduits in that direction. At standstill, the stator can deliver 4.4 Nm of continuous torque to maintain load position without overheating. Under rated excitation, the shaft reaches 6000 rpm, allowing rapid index cycles on light to medium inertia loads. The motor is supplied without a blocking brake, so holding force during power-off must be provided by the drive or by external mechanical locking. A standard housing protects the windings, and length code B indicates the active stack used in the stator frame. The motor also uses a single-ended shaft, with no side-B extension, to keep the installation envelope compact.

Feedback for commutation and closed-loop control is generated by Digital servo feedback (DSF), which sends position data to the drive through the motor connector. The load couples to a plain shaft, and the housing is fitted with a shaft seal to help restrict dust or coolant ingress along the journal. Frame size 071 gives the motor a compact footprint for multi-axis assemblies. The connector-based electrical interface keeps power and feedback connections organized within the machine layout.
